MONTPELIER, VT. (AP) - U.S. Sen. Patrick Leahy of Vermont is renewing his fascination with Batman with a cameo appearance in “The Dark Knight Rises,” which will get its first public showing in his home state.

Leahy was invited to be in the movie and says he learned recently he’ll appear in a scene with Christian Bale, who plays Batman, and Morgan Freeman.

The movie will be screened July 15 in Williston ahead of its July 20 U.S. premiere.

Leahy says Warner Bros. CEO Barry Meyer will join him at the Vermont screening.

The Democratic senator has had a lifelong fascination with the Caped Crusader. In 2007, he appeared in “The Dark Knight.”

The Vermont showing will benefit a Montpelier (mont-PEEL’-yer) children’s library and a Burlington environmental education center named for Leahy.
